One thing I love about them is that they lost a bunch of money with Bernie Madoff but Kevin Bacon said this about it:

It sucked, and we were certainly angry and all the things. But then we woke up the next day and said, 'What do we got? We love each other. We love our children. We’re healthy. No one took away our ability to make a living.' So we got back to work.

Kevin Bacon's dad was just regular rich instead of uber rich, but also hugely influential in Philadelphia's architectural history. Apparently he would buy swathes of historic houses and resell them at incredibly low prices with conditions that instead of demolishing them, the new homeowners had to restore them instead.
